Transaction 418e56fd71de358754a0f5b11773b8b42fd4bc1db9f9975fd694500c1297c8f6

62 Input
2 Outputs
  • 418e56fd71de358754a0f5b11773b8b42fd4bc1db9f9975fd694500c1297c8f6:0
  • value  748585
    address  39DJvYykL9s6ZwU7SKZXzaeJAaBcPGED45
  • 418e56fd71de358754a0f5b11773b8b42fd4bc1db9f9975fd694500c1297c8f6:1
  • value  429008498
    address  3M7SxVXrM8svUWBzbhh5TYro7ECLLERzpR